Realtek nic its very versatile and have more registers for
 optimise  and solve different issues.  I added 2 parameters rx_buf_sz and
 txpacketmax  1.Parameter rx_buf_sz represent Receive Packet Maximum size and
 on   this program is 16383 bytes, eg RTL 8101E use 16000 and user may use  
 alls values up to maximum but value great from zero.   If a received packet
 of packet length larger than the value set here, then it will set  both RWT
 and RES bits in the corresponding Rx Status Descriptor. If the packet,  which
 is larger than the RMS value, is received without CRC error, it is still a
 good  packet, although both RWT and RES bits are set in the corresponding Rx
 Status  Descriptor.  2. Parameter txpacketmax represent Max Transmit Packet
 Size value must be on  range 1-63.Do not put zero on any situation.Every
 field from range 1-63 have  128 bytes.  For regular LAN applications, i.e.,
 the max packet size is either 1518 or 1522 (VLAN) bytes, this field must be
 larger than the max packet size. E.g., 0x0C. On mee working good with
 txpacketmax=60 and rx_buf_sz=1600
